Step into Hamilton for the 2026 edition of the Road2Hope Marathon on November 1st as it weaves through the city's stunning waterfront. This race weekend includes multiple distances to suit all levels, from seasoned athletes tackling the full marathon to families with options like the MIZUNO Elite 5K and Hammer the Hammer. Participants will gather at Dundas Street West near the vibrant waterfront promenade on race morning. The course begins along Main Street and James Street North before heading east towards Barton Street, then looping back via John Street South. Spectacular city skyline views and scenic parks and gardens offer a picturesque backdrop to your journey. Although elevation changes are minimal with slight inclines throughout, the route ensures a varied yet manageable terrain. On race day, expect an early start as temperatures range from 1.8°C to 8.4°C, making it feel slightly chilly but comfortable for most runners despite high humidity levels that can make conditions seem colder than they actually are. Wind speeds average around 14.6km/h, which might require adjustments in pacing strategies. Aid stations will be strategically placed every 2km along the route to ensure hydration and support for both marathoners and those participating in shorter races. For a unique challenge, participants can opt for the Hammer Challenge by completing three races over the weekend at an additional cost. Registration is open from October 31st through November 1st, 2025, via the official website: https://raceroster.com/events/2026/112212/2026-hamilton-marathon-road2hope. Fees range from $44.73 for the MIZUNO Elite 5K to $212.59 for Hammer the Hammer, with additional costs depending on your chosen race. Bibs can be picked up at the Hamilton Civic Centre between October 30th and November 1st, daily from 8am-7pm, requiring valid photo ID and confirmation emails or receipts. This event welcomes runners aged 16 years and older, though age requirements may vary slightly for specific races like the Kids Run. About Hamilton
Learn more about the host city, Hamilton.
Hamilton is a port city in Ontario with a population around 520,000, at the westernmost end of Lake Ontario—the city wraps around the lake and continues towards the Niagara Escarpment, referred to by locals as "the mountain".
